Wiley weighed in at 150.5 for the Phoenix fight, and I don't think it would have been hard for him to get down to 143. But Top Rank didn't seem to want to make the match. On October 10th, the Arizona Republic ran an article that included the following segment:

"Arum isn't happy with comments from Grover Wiley, the car salesman who has been making fun of Julio Cesar Chavez since he beat him Sept. 17 at America West Arena. Arum says Wiley has talked himself out of a bout with Chavez' son. J.C. Chavez Jr. But Arum might have to listen to the son, who said before and after his victory Saturday night over Jeremy Stiers that Wiley is the only fight he wants."

And then a few days later, an interview (http://www.thesweetscience.com/boxing-article/2741/superstar/) with Top Rank matchmaker Bruce Trampler said he didn't think he was ready for the match.

'"I couldn't stop him from fighting whoever he wants, but I certainly don't think that is a good fight for him right now," Trampler said of Wiley, a wily veteran who is 30-6-1 (14 KOs). "Julio Jr. is calling the guy out. That's what fighters are supposed to do and it is commendable. But that's why they have managers: to stop them from talking with their heart instead of their head. Wiley is a strong, solid guy. There will be plenty of time to chase him down the road."'

The official reason for the fight not taking place is the weight, but I don't know. Now they're putting Junior in against Kevin Payne, which is a huge disappointment for me. They could at least have given ***an the rematch he's been promised for so long.
